The Performance Gap: Why Consumer Mirrors Fail in Professional Settings

In the B2B sector, the cost of equipment failure extends beyond the price of the unit. Consumer-grade vanity mirrors often suffer from hinge fatigue, color temperature instability, and battery safety risks. Unlike professional equipment, these units are rarely engineered to survive the rigors of transit or the high-frequency use typical of professional makeup artistry and hospitality settings. For procurement specialists, the distinction lies in documented material science and validated testing protocols.

Optical Engineering: Defining Professional Standards for Clarity and CRI

Optical clarity in a portable mirror requires precision mounting that resists flex-induced distortion. For instance, our Square Led Desktop Vanity Mirror utilizes high-index glass housing to maintain a flat surface even under temperature-induced structural movement. Central to professional performance is the Color Rendering Index (CRI). Our SM612A-SL series integrates 70-bead LED arrays tested to exceed CRI Ra>95, ensuring that colors appear as they would under natural daylight. This is verified through International Commission on Illumination standards, providing the color-critical accuracy required for professional applications.

Mechanical Resilience: Material Science for Portable Enclosures

Durability in portable mirrors is achieved through material selection and rigorous testing. We utilize high-grade ABS injection molding designed for high impact resistance. In our production line, we subject hinge assemblies to a 5,000-cycle fold test to ensure the unit retains its structural integrity during repeated daily use. By moving away from brittle, low-grade polymers, we reduce the risk of casing deformation and internal component strain, ensuring that the final Led Desktop Makeup Hollywood Mirror can handle the transit stress common in commercial logistics.

Electrical Safety: Critical Standards for Lithium-Powered Portable Vanity Lighting

When sourcing rechargeable units, safety is non-negotiable. Our lithium-ion management systems are UL and CE certified, meeting the requirements of the International Electrotechnical Commission for consumer electronics. Furthermore, we implement proprietary thermal PCB management for our 70-bead LED arrays. This prevents heat buildup in the enclosure, which is a primary cause of battery cell degradation and casing discoloration over time. Ensuring stable power delivery requires strict adherence to voltage regulation standards to prevent thermal runaway.

Beyond Specs: The Role of Factory QC and Stress-Testing Protocols

Our quality control starts at the raw material stage. We employ AQL (Acceptable Quality Limit) sampling, specifically adhering to ISO 2859-1 standards for inspection. During our routine factory audits, we verify cosmetic finish and mechanical tolerance on every batch. Each SM612A-SL unit undergoes drop-simulation testing to ensure that the internal wiring remains shock-proof. By documenting these checkpoints, we provide our B2B partners with the transparency needed to mitigate supply chain risks.

Frequently Asked Questions

Q: What is the significance of the CRI Ra>95 standard for makeup mirrors?

A: CRI or Color Rendering Index of 95 or higher ensures the light source accurately reflects colors, preventing discrepancies during makeup application and professional cosmetic tasks.

Q: How do you verify hinge durability in your portable mirrors?

A: We utilize automated mechanical testing rigs that put our foldable components through 5,000+ opening and closing cycles to ensure longevity and structural resilience.

Q: Are your lithium battery modules compliant with international safety standards?

A: Yes, all rechargeable lithium modules are UL and CE certified, strictly adhering to IEC standards for safety in portable consumer electronics.

Q: What is your AQL standard for quality control?

A: We follow ISO 2859-1 standards for AQL, ensuring that every batch of mirrors undergoes rigorous cosmetic and mechanical sampling before shipment.

Q: How does thermal management affect mirror longevity?

A: Proper thermal management via PCB design prevents heat accumulation near the battery and LED components, which directly reduces the risk of component failure and plastic housing degradation.
